Output ed677637519005e9b97d8822424196c830dd88638c32abd9021823050bc8eae2:7

value
15294821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7aaa9a8858b8e041872072842592aff6b459ba OP_EQUAL
address
3QXRoWkFFopXHa6MaJKzaxsBffRa4Nbxf3
transaction
ed677637519005e9b97d8822424196c830dd88638c32abd9021823050bc8eae2
confirmations
268724
spent
true